Spezifikationen
| Attribut | Wert |
| Series | MSP430I2xx |
| Part Status | Active |
| DigiKey Programmable | Not Verified |
| Core Processor | MSP430 CPU16 |
| Core Size | 16-Bit |
| Speed | 16.384Mhz |
| Connectivity | I2C, IrDA, SCI, SPI, UART/USART |
| Peripherals | Brown-out Detect/Reset, PWM, WDT |
| Number of I/O | 12 |
| Program Memory Size | 32KB (32K x 8) |
| Program Memory Type | FLASH |
| RAM Size | 2K x 8 |
| Voltage - Supply (Vcc/Vdd) | 2.2V ~ 3.6V |
| Data Converters | A/D 3x24b Sigma-Delta |
| Oscillator Type | External |
| Operating Temperature | -40°C ~ 105°C (TA) |
| Mounting Type | Surface Mount |
| Supplier Device Package | 28-TSSOP |
| Package / Case | 28-TSSOP (0.173", 4.40mm Width) |
| Base Product Number | MSP430I2031 |
